Al Yamamah College: Al Yamamah College is a selective private institution of higher education accredited by the Ministry of Higher Education, with English as the medium of instruction. It opened its door to the public September 2004 by offering an undergraduate program in Business Administration and soon will be offering Information Technology and MBA programs. Its foundation year English programs are handled through a partnership with U.S.-based INTERLINK Language Centers (www.ESLus.com), its business programs have been designed and developed by Simon Frasier University in Vancouver, Canada and its IT curriculum by DePaul University in Chicago, USA.
